作业帮 > 综合 > 作业

MATLAB中怎么求y=β0+β1*x+β2*x*x+β3*x*x*x+.一直到N的判定系数~可怜可怜我吧~

来源:学生作业帮 编辑:搜搜做题作业网作业帮 分类:综合作业 时间:2024/06/13 16:07:36
MATLAB中怎么求y=β0+β1*x+β2*x*x+β3*x*x*x+.一直到N的判定系数~可怜可怜我吧~
就是在做线性回归是怎样才能出来这样的图和结果
MATLAB中怎么求y=β0+β1*x+β2*x*x+β3*x*x*x+.一直到N的判定系数~可怜可怜我吧~
如果你是要求y,见mony_ksy的算法.如果你是要求β,可以使用曲线拟合的函数polyfit
------------------------
看见你贴的图了.这是一个回归诊断工具箱,可以很方便的输出各种统计量.
举个最简单的例子,比如你想拟合的数据是
X=[0:0.2:10];
y=[0:2:100];
调用
regstats(y,X)
就可以了.
然后在你想输出的统计量前面打对勾,点OK,这个统计量就到workspace里了.
比如你想要beta,那就在coefficient这一项前面打对勾.